We are one of the world’s leading economic consulting firms. We strive to recruit and develop talented people to work together to produce meaningful economic analysis of exceptional quality, and to create a positive impact on our clients and society.Our International Arbitration practice provides independent economic analysis, valuation and regulatory opinions, damages assessments, expert reports and arbitration testimony.We believe that working in diverse teams, where everybody’s views are considered and respected, helps us to deliver work of the highest standards of quality and integrity.About the Opportunity:We are currently recruiting for theSenior Analystposition in the International Arbitration practice in our Paris and/or London offices.Our Senior Analysts usually join us after obtaining an undergraduate degree in Economics and a master’s degree in Finance or Economics, and after completing at least two years of relevant work experience.As a Senior Analyst, you will have the opportunity to make a real contribution from day one and become an integral part of the team. You will be involved in all aspects of a case, developing robust economic analyses and valuation assessments, and working closely with experts, case managers and junior staff members. Senior Analysts are expected to demonstrate strong numerical skills, attention to detail, sound analytical judgment, initiative and strong team skills.Key Responsibilities:Contributing to discussions about the theoretical and empirical approach of the analysesCollating and analysing qualitative and quantitative research and client data to assess clients’ businessesAnalysing financial statements and building complex and customised valuation models (e.g., DCF and/or relative valuation)Assist in training analysts in financial tools and research methodsManaging and supervising junior analystsDrafting presentations, memoranda and sections in reports summarising analysesLiaising with clients and law firmsEducation, Experience and Skills Required:Master’s degree in Finance or Economics with an undergraduate degree in Economics
